Ticket: retention sweeper deletes records one day early. Repro: seed the Hollowmere staging store with records expiring tomorrow, run the sweeper with default config, observe premature deletion. Suspect an off-by-one in the cutoff comparison. To trigger a manual sweep for verification, call the admin endpoint with the service token that follows.

portal login ticket: eyJhbGciOiJIUzI1NiIsInR5cCI6IkpXVCJ9.eyJzdWIiOiIwEOsktwVNwIn0.-UJU3fdyyCgG

TICKET: Queuewright-209 — config drift during job queue replacement. While migrating from the homegrown Taskmill queue to the new Conveyly broker, two worker pools in the Hollis cluster retained old retry and visibility settings, causing duplicate job execution on payroll batches. The drift stems from an ansible run that predated the freeze. On-call: please verify each pool against source before re-enabling autoscaling, and flag any mismatch. The intended baseline configuration for all pools is below.

deployment values, yadug-bawif:
[framir]
team = pelox
access_code = ac_a38ab2
owner = tamion.julael
host = framir.tolvaqlabs.test
port = 11211
peer = tammir.zemvargrid.local
salt = 2215ef03
pin = 1541

**PR: add bloom filter ahead of Cellarmap reads**

Cuts pointless disk lookups for absent keys. Filter is rebuilt on compaction; stale bits only cause false positives, never misses. Memory cost is fixed per shard. Reviewer: check the sizing math against expected key counts. The filter parameters chosen for this rollout are below.

constants for tajep-kahag:
RATE_LIMITS = {
    "oliath": 1,
    "druael": 10,
}

Visitors may not enter the Corvel Hardware Lab unescorted. Log every guest at reception, issue a red lanyard, and confirm their host meets them at the lab door. No photography inside. Escorts remain with visitors at all times. If the host is unreachable within ten minutes, cancel the visit. The lab entry code for escorting staff is below.

badge for hagug-yagaf: bdg-CUQCLS-57047080